Thaller, Manfred – Historical Methods, 1995
Discusses new developments in digitizing manuscripts. Introduces four categories describing level of detail for digital images in historical information systems. These are illustrative, readable, Paleographic quality, and enhanceable. Examines traditional architecture, tagged manuscripts, and approaches to full-text integration. (MJP)
